When planning a trip through Crystal Palace Station, expect a range of facilities aimed at ensuring a smooth journey. The station features a well-stocked ticket office, open from early morning until late evening, making it easy for passengers to purchase or collect tickets. Ticket machines, including accessible versions, are available to assist with ticketing needs. Travelers requiring information or help can approach the friendly ticket office staff and customer help points.
Accessibility is a key focus here, with step-free access being a notable feature, ensuring that the station accommodates all passengers. Facilities such as induction loops, ramp access to trains, and accessible ticket machines highlight the station's commitment to inclusivity. While the station offers seating areas, it lacks a waiting room, but you can still find refreshments both in the ticket hall and on Platform 1. Though there is no luggage storage or cycle hire service, the station provides secure bicycle stands and sheltered parking for cyclists.

Carlisle station is equipped with a robust ticketing system, featuring a ticket office with extensive hours from 5:00 am to 8:00 pm on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 9:00 am on Sundays. There are ticket machines for easy access and collection, including accessible options for those with disabilities. The station ensures comfort and ease with step-free access, available lifts, and ramp assistance across all platforms, making travel uncomplicated for everyone.
The waiting areas are plentiful, with seating on all platforms, and for those unexpected longer waits, there are refreshment facilities and a newsagent to help pass the time. Although there’s no First-Class lounge, the station does offer standard amenities like 24-hour toilets on platforms 4/6, complete with a changing place for those requiring it.
